Prevent Unauthorized Changes to Compliance Audit Fields

Use Salesforce Validation Rules to restrict audit field updates to compliance users

In many organizations, sales representatives conduct screenings throughout the sales process. They are typically part of the Standard User permission group in the sanctions.io application, allowing them to initiate screenings without making compliance decisions.

In most cases, this setup is sufficient: Sales users are instructed not to modify screening alerts, leaving all auditing and compliance actions to the compliance team.

As an additional layer of control, some companies choose to fully restrict updates to compliance audit fields, ensuring that only designated compliance roles can modify them. This can be achieved using native Salesforce Validation Rules.

Use Case

  • Allow Sales users to run screenings.

  • Prevent Sales users from editing audit or compliance fields.

  • Restrict audit actions to Compliance, Sales Managers, or System Administrators.

How to set it up

1. In Setup, navigate to Object Manager.

2. Locate and select the Screening Alert object.

3. Select Validation Rules, then click New.

4. Enter the validation rule formula as shown below:

AND(
NOT(
OR(
$Profile.Name = "System Administrator",
$Profile.Name = "Sales Manager",
$Profile.Name = "Compliance User"
)
),
OR(
ISCHANGED( Sanctions__Compliance_Audited__c ),
ISCHANGED( Sanctions__Auditor__c ),
ISCHANGED( Sanctions__Audit_Comments__c ),
ISCHANGED( Sanctions__Audit_Time__c )
)
)

5. Add an Error Message, such as:

You do not have permission to update compliance audit fields. Please contact the Compliance team or your Salesforce administrator.

With this validation rule in place:

  • Sales users can continue to initiate and view screenings.

  • Only approved compliance profiles can update audit-related fields.

  • Compliance processes are protected using standard Salesforce functionality.
